In this review of the Columbia Girls Benton Springs 1510633, the bottom line is simple: this is a lightweight, hooded rain jacket built to keep active children dry without weighing them down. The jacket's waterproof Hydroplus 100% nylon shell and practical design elements make it a reliable choice for school commutes, spring showers, and outdoor play. Reviewers find it easy to layer over a sweatshirt, appreciate the fit and bright colors, and note that it balances packable convenience with everyday weather protection.
Key Features
- Waterproof shell: The Hydroplus 100% nylon outer layer sheds heavy rain so kids stay dry during downpours and puddle play.
- Protective hood: A built-in hood offers quick shelter from driving rain and can be thrown back when not needed.
- Drop tail: The extended rear hem helps keep the lower back covered while bending or wearing a backpack.
- Elastic cuffs: Snug elastic cuffs seal out wind and water at the wrists for better warmth retention.
- Reflective detail: Small reflective accents increase visibility on gray mornings and late afternoons.
- Modern classic fit: The cut allows a comfortable range of motion and room to layer a sweatshirt underneath when needed.
Who It's For
The Benton Springs jacket is aimed at parents seeking a practical, everyday rain layer for girls who play outdoors, walk to school, or need a packable coat for travel. Its lightweight construction and waterproof shell suit spring and mild-winter use rather than extreme cold.
It is less suitable for buyers who want heavy insulation or a thick winter parka; customers seeking a lined, thermal jacket for prolonged cold weather should consider a model with inner insulation rather than this streamlined raincoat.
Pros & Cons
Pros
- Lightweight and packable for easy storage in backpacks or lockers.
- Waterproof Hydroplus nylon shell keeps rain out during persistent showers.
- Fit accommodates a sweatshirt underneath while allowing freedom of movement.
- Practical details like a protective hood, drop tail, and reflective elements add daily usability.
Cons
- Material is relatively thin, so it provides little insulation in cold weather.
- Sizing reports are mixed, so trying on or checking measurements is advisable.
Specifications
| Brand | Columbia Children's Apparel |
| Model | Girls Benton Springs 1510633 |
| Shell material | Hydroplus 100% nylon |
| Key features | Waterproof shell, hood, elastic cuffs, drop tail, reflective detail |
| Fit | Modern classic fit with room to layer |
| Intended use | Everyday rainwear and light outdoor activity |
